How to be Organized at Work

Set time apart during, after or before your work day to do creative planning and thinking about what you want to accomplish for the day and how you can do it.

Even though sometimes tasks come to you during the day unexpectedly, try to arrange your day so that tasks flow together efficiently. Try to keep your work space looking as organized as possible. Remember that other people may be watching you and forming their own opinions.

Cultivating Assertiveness

Assertiveness is important, especially in a challenging work environment.
Assertiveness can be cultivated by placing priority on ones own needs. Nothing is wrong with pleasing others after pleasing yourself.

It is important to cultivate the habit of asking others for help when you need it. It is also important to express your feelings to others.Be a go-getter. You don't have to step on others to get ahead in the world.

How Important is GPA in Getting The Job You Want?

Grade point average is one of the things that can show how outstanding you are as a student. However a high grade point average is not the only thing that potential employers look for when considering a candidate’s ability to contribute to their organization.

In fact, employers will often use internship performance to establish whether a student has really learnt and knows how to apply what they learnt. They want to know that students can apply knowledge to solve problems in the real world.

Interview Answers-Tell Me a Little About Yourself

"Tell me about yourself."
This request requires a short summary of your best character traits. Focus especially on those that will be an asset in the position you are applying for.

Be honest. Talk about the values which are important to you as a professional as well. Such values may include customer satisfaction and quality, for example.

Interview Colors

Your choice of color for your interview suit should reflect the image you would like to present. Neutral colors are appropriate for interviews. You don't want to stir up anyone's predjudices just because you chose a color they don't like.

For men, colors such as charcoal gray or navy blue are recommended.
